AGENDA
9:05 a.m. – 10:35 a.m.
Florida Rules of Criminal Procedure 3.111(e) and
Appellate Procedure 9.140(d) – Part I
- What the Rules Require
The Right to Appeal / Notice of Appeal
Statement of Judicial Acts to Be Reviewed
Directions to the Clerk
Designations to the Court Reporter
- The Filing Fee and Fee Orders from the District Court
10:45 a.m. – 11:55 a.m. Part II
- Moving to Withdraw
- Conditional Withdrawal: Rule 3.800(b)(2)
- The Order
- Application for Indigent Status for Appeal
- Indigent for Costs via the Judicial Administrative Commission
- Being Proactive while Protecting Your Client’s Right to Appeal: Potential Revisions to Engagement Letters /
Fee Agreements / Contracts for Trial Representation
